Please note: Adult programs are noted in purple and Children/Teen programs are noted in green.

Click on any program item to learn more information. Please note that registration is required for some programs as indicated. Please call 941-7072 with any questions.

Monday 10:00 am - 6:00 pm
Tuesday 10:00 am - 8:00 pm
Wednesday 10:00 am - 6:00 pm
Thursday 10:00 am - 8:00 pm
Friday 10:00 am - 6:00 pm
Saturday 10:00 am - 4:00 pm
Sunday 1:00 pm - 5:00 pm
Closed Sundays in August

You can follow our calendar, elect to receive an email feed about upcoming programs, and/or sync selected programs to your personal calendar with this free service: